Romania Takes Emergency Steps to Raise Danube Levels for Cernavoda Nuclear Plant Cooling
8/22/2026, 8:33:47 PM
Core Event: Reactor Shutdowns and Emergency Water-Boost Measures
Romania’s last operating nuclear reactor was shut down on August 13 after historically low water levels in the Danube River threatened the plant’s cooling supply. The shutdown left the Cernavoda Nuclear Power Plant without nuclear generation, prompting the National Committee for Emergency Situations to approve a suite of emergency actions on August 22. Measures include emergency dredging of the Danube channel near the plant, construction of a groyne on the Old Danube channel to divert water toward the plant’s intake, deployment of high-capacity pumps, and a five-day release of additional water from the Olt River reservoirs.
Background & Context: River-Dependent Energy Amid Record Low Flows
Low water levels have affected major European rivers, disrupting traffic and forcing nuclear facilities in Romania, Bulgaria and Hungary to curtail output. In Romania, the Cernavoda reactors—each about 700 MW and together supplying roughly 20 % of the nation’s electricity—rely on Danube water for cooling. The decline in river flow follows a broader regional trend of decades-low river levels that have heightened energy-price pressures.
Official Statements & Responses
Nuclearelectrica, the state-owned operator, described the August 13 shutdown of Unit 2 as a controlled action that does not pose a nuclear-safety risk. Authorities have also declared an energy emergency for August, urging households and businesses to reduce consumption during peak hours and increasing electricity production from coal, hydropower, wind, and imports.
Data & Statistics
- Two reactors at Cernavoda: ? 700 MW each.
- Combined output: ? 20 % of Romania’s electricity.
- Hidroelectrica will release an additional average of 50 cubic meters per second from Olt River reservoirs for five days.
- Emergency dredging and pump deployment are intended to maintain the water level required for cooling.
What’s Next: Ongoing Dredging and Energy Management
The emergency dredging and water-diversion structure will continue while high-capacity pumps remain on standby. Romania’s energy ministry plans to rely on alternative generation sources and imports to offset the loss of nuclear output for the remainder of the month, while monitoring Danube levels for any further operational impacts.
